Job Summary

We are looking for a new Development Engineer who wants to develop and improve our Prepress & Digital printing technology and equipment.  

You will join a diverse team consisting of different engineers. The Printing team within D&T Industrial Base Engineering at Tetra Pak has the responsibility to develop, maintain and improve global specifications within PrePress, Printing & Digital Printing. We are the global owner of various equipment and process specifications and drive optimization and standardization of our end-to-end graphics operations.

Work includes problem-solving, support within technology know how, setting requirements, implement solutions and support installations in production. You will be leading or participating in development activities and collaborating both internally and with external partners. 

This position is based in Lund, Sweden but you will work in a global arena. Some travel is expected, maximum 25 % of your time.
